Connect New GFCI Outlet. Using the wire cutter or stripper, strip about 1/2 inch of insulation from the ends of each wire. Then, connect the wires to the new GFCI outlet. Be sure to connect the wires to the appropriate terminals, which are typically labeled "line" and "load."

If you previously had a switch and only two wires (not counted ground - green or bare), then no, you cannot add an outlet. What you have is a switch loop - hot from the panel (via the outlet or light box) and switched hot back to the outlet or light. For the outlet, you also need a neutral wire. Turn off the breaker that controls the circuit with the breaker so you don’t shock yourself. Unscrew the old GFCI outlet from the wall and detach all of the wires that connect to it. My GFI outlet stopped working, and after trying the usual methods to get it r...GFCI outlets are larger than normal ones, and the space is limited. But if there is sufficient space, splice all the black wires together with a wire nut, including a 6" piece of additional wire. Do the same with the white wires and the ground wires. Here are the four most effective ways to test a GFCI outlet. 1. “TEST” Button. Every GFCI receptacle has “TEST” and “RESET” buttons. These buttons are located in the center of the outlet. The “TEST” button is typically black, while the “RESET” button is usually red. Both of these buttons are intended to test the GFCI outlet ...

The average cost of hiring an electrician to replace a GFCI outlet is between $130 and $300. The price can vary depending on the electrician and whether they are charging by the hour or task. A Ground Fault Circuit Interrupter (GFCI) acts almost immediately to shut off electrical power in as little as 1/40 of a second.
